Best Areas to Invest in North Goa Real Estate
North Goa real estate is a synonym for lively nightlife, exciting beaches and continuous tourism inflows. This is why it's an ideal location for investment. most desirable areas to buy in Goa in case rental income is your primary goal.
1. Calangute & Baga
-
Also known as Calangute is known as the "Queen of Beaches," Calangute is a favorite among Indian as well as international travelers.
-
The rental apartments of Goa in India see between 80 and 90 90% occupancy during peak times.
-
Studio and holiday homes are extremely sought after.
2. Anjuna & Vagator
-
Popular for its live music and nightclubs.
-
Travelers who are young prefer the rental villas and apartments in Goa in this area.
-
The potential is high for an Airbnb-style source of income.
3. Morjim, Ashwem & Mandrem
-
Also known as "Little Russia" due to Russian tourists as well as NRI customers.
-
Boutique and luxury resorts draw guests for long-term stay.
-
Price increases are steady which makes it among the most lucrative places to invest your money on North Goa real estate.
4. Mapusa & Siolim
-
A growing demand for apartments that are budget-friendly.
-
Ideal for tenants who are long-term (working professionals Locals, working professionals, students).

Best Areas to Invest in South Goa Property
South Goa property attracts those seeking peace, privacy and quality. It's less crowded, however it provides premium appreciation to long-term investment.
1. Colva & Benaulim
-
One of the most sought-after South Goa beaches.
-
Luxurious holiday homes and villas dominate this area.
-
A growing demand for NRIs looking to retirement homes.
2. Palolem & Agonda
-
Beaches with calm waters, popular for yoga retreats as well as wellness tourism.
-
Villas and holiday homes located in South Goa have great opportunities for rentals during the season.
3. Vasco da Gama & Margao
-
Urban areas that have hospitals, schools, as well as connectivity.
-
Cheap homes located in Goa to long-term stay residents.
4. Cavelossim & Varca
-
The resorts are known for their five-star status as well as luxury properties.
-
Attracts corporate holiday buyers and NRIs homeowners.
Property Price Trends in North and South Goa
Prices for property vary greatly in North Goa and South Goa, driven by the demand for tourism, infrastructure and the appeal of lifestyle.
-
North Goa: Apartments close to Baga or Anjuna vary from around Rs70 lakhs to about Rs 2 crores. Villas with luxury amenities near Morjim and Vagator may be more than 5 crores.
-
South Goa: Apartments located in Margao and Vasco da Gama begin at the sum of Rs50 lakhs. The villas in the vicinity of Palolem or Colva vary in price from Rs1.5 crores up to four crores.
South Goa vs North Goa property returns: North Goa offers greater rental yields; South Goa offers better long-term appreciation.
Why Is North Goa Popular for Rentals and Nightlife?
Tourists love North Goa beaches including Baga, Anjuna, and Vagator to enjoy nightlife as well as water sports as well as festivals. The result is a high demand for:
-
Rent apartments in Goa
-
Vacation homes for short-term use
-
Stays in Airbnb style
The owners of the apartments are able to get rent from their apartments located in North Goa year-round, particularly during the New Year and festivals.

Common Challenges in Goa Property Investment
-
Verified Listings - Many homes are sold without sufficient documentation.
-
Pricey Offers - Demand from tourists increases the prices of popular areas.
-
Seasonal Rental Changes - The rental earnings in Goa could be seasonally fluctuating.
-
Confusion Areas - Buyers are unable to determine which one is the best for investing: North or South Goa.
